Online learning is a significant investment for those willing to advance their careers, upgrade their skill set, or change careers while pursuing a full-time degree program or doing a job. Engaging the learners, eliminating monotonousness, and motivating them for continuous learning is the key priority of an e-learning program.

Assignments, quizzes, and industrial projects play a major role in attracting and engaging learners with multiple responsibilities and different goals. As a higher training completion rate indicates that learners are able to meet their goals and course developers are serving their customers right, a variety of assessments are included in the training to benefit both parties with different purposes. Let's take a look at a few forms of online assessment techniques and how they make the online learning experience better.

  1. Quizzes – Multiple choice, fill in the blanks, true-false, arrange in order, and match the following are a few common formats of quizzes used in both online and offline education. Quizzes help retain information in an interactive format and exercise the brain, enhances concentration, and attention power while finding a solution to a specific problem. They compel the brain to retrieve data, solve problems, and make remembering easier. Quizzes also help in preparing for the next or advanced stage of learning once the basic level concepts are mastered.

Quizzes also help in detecting gaps in learning. Incorrect answers to any questions help develop an understanding of what concepts are the learners lagging behind in and encourages them to revisit those topics and strengthen their knowledge. While solving quizzes, learners get a different perspective of the subject matter, reduce stress, test themselves, develop enthusiasm to continue learning and complete upcoming challenges, build confidence when they witness their progress, and help in revising the concepts.

  1. Reading and listening comprehension – With communication becoming a major in-demand skill across industries, learners are increasingly enrolling in online language training. Imbedding features that can test learner's reading, listening, writing, and speaking skills are essential to ensure that the learning goals are achieved timely and accurately. This helps in eliminating imbalance among specific skills and allows the learners to become as good in speaking and reading as they might be in listening or writing.

In such features, let us say if a student is learning French, the learners see a word like 'Félicitations' it's phonetic 'fayli-si-taa-sion' and its audio pronunciation on the screen. After going through these, the learners could record themselves speaking the word/phrase via the microphone and check if their pronunciation is correct or not.

Reading and listening comprehension builds language understanding and accuracy, tests all the aspects of a language and polishes overall professional communication ability, and has a positive impact on learning. It also motivates learners to explore new words, practice more, and make their skills better. Overall, the feature tests one's ability to present themselves in the real world and apply their language skills professionally.

Assignments and projects – Working on a few minor and major projects while learning online builds core domain practical skills, enhances problem-solving skills, strengthens researching abilities, gives a different perspective of the subject matter, polishes analyzing skills, and makes a learner ready to solve real-world problems. Through project-based learning, learners identify a problem, define objectives, design and develop the solution, and evaluate and demonstrate it.

Multiple projects to assess learners' knowledge of every module is essential in online training. Assignments usually differ based on the subject: so, in a digital marketing training where the learners conduct a website SEO audit, create an email campaign, or Google ad campaign, in a C and C++ training they would create a cricket game or gully cricket app. This clearly defines that assignments and projects are focused on creating a habit of practice, sharpening domain knowledge, and making them internship/ job-ready. Projects or assignments reinforce the concepts learned during lectures, motivate for exploring more, help in completing the training on time, improve learners' performance, give the instructor insight into learners' in-depth learning ability, validate the skills, and add weight to learners resumes.
